What goes into the rating: Representation: how much weight one vote carries here compared with a statewide vote — the smaller the district, the more each vote counts. Decisiveness: how likely this race is to be close, based on past results or current analyst ratings, plus the number of candidates.
Representation: High · 66 out of 100
This district is a small slice of its state, so each vote here carries much more weight than a vote in a statewide race. About 632,780 people live here.
Show the representation math
score = 50 + 50 × ln(state population ÷ this district's) ÷ ln(50,000) = 50 + 50 × ln(22,416,077 ÷ 632,780) ÷ ln(50,000) = 66.49, measured against a statewide vote in FL (grades: 66+ high, 33+ normal, otherwise low; a statewide race is the 50 baseline)

Candidates
Republican · declared
Micah Loyd is a Republican candidate for the open Brevard County Board of County Commissioners District 1 (North Brevard) seat in the 2026 Republican primary. He has served as a commissioner on the Canaveral Port Authority Board, representing District 2, since his election in 2016.
Republican · declared
Pam Avery is a Republican candidate for the open Brevard County Board of County Commissioners District 1 (North Brevard) seat in the 2026 Republican primary. The District 1 seat is currently vacant. She has not previously held county office.
Republican · declared
Rick Heffelfinger is a Republican candidate for the open Brevard County Board of County Commissioners District 1 (North Brevard) seat in the 2026 Republican primary. He is known locally for regularly speaking at county commission meetings on government transparency and budgeting. He has not previously held elected office.
Republican · declared
Stel Bailey is a Republican candidate for the open Brevard County Board of County Commissioners District 1 (North Brevard) seat in the 2026 Republican primary. She is an investigative journalist and environmental advocate running on government accountability and environmental issues. She has not previously held elected office.
